I’m very pleased to say that today sees the release of my latest album, Lambent, on my great friend Andrew Paine’s label, Sonic Oyster Records.

Lambent - white cover

Perhaps best described as a haunting, minimalistic and mystical dream-narrative inspired, very loosely, by Viscount Samuel’s book ‘An Unknown Land’ (London, George Allen & Unwin, 1942), the disc is available in a very limited edition of 50 copies, most of which are now gone. I have a few copies, and Andrew may still have some at the time of writing. They come in handstamped sleeves: 25 in black ink on white card, 25 in white ink on black card.
